Painkiller Hell and Damnation arrives on Halloween for PC
"Toned down" version for consoles (and PCs) next year
Painkiller will soon make its glorious return, as Painkiller Hell & Damnation arrives for the PC on October 31. Publisher Nordic Games says this version is the "totally uncut" experience, while a "toned down" one arrives on January 22, 2013, for the PC, PS3, and Xbox 360.
Hell & Damnation is an HD remake of the 2004 game and its expansion, Battle Out of Hell. The original game was developed by People Can Fly; however the new version is being handled by The Farm 51.
Painkiller Hell & Damnation is a Steamworks title, runs on Unreal Engine 3, and features some of the nastiest denizens of Hell you'll ever face. You need to rely on skill and firepower to survive the onslaught, as this first-person shooter is about as old school as it gets. There's no regenerating health or kill streak bonuses here, just some old-fashioned gaming.
The game is available to pre-purchase on Steam for $20 for the regular edition or $30 for the collector's edition. The CE features a soundtrack, making of video, Tarot Card DLC, Multiplayer Body Skin DLC, and more. There are also pre-purchase rewards, with the already unlocked first tier granting immediate access to the beta. The second tier includes the Body Skin DLC, while the third tier is a copy of Painkiller: Black Edition.
